Totalitarianism had risen after World War I because they want for their countries, which were burdened with vast amounts of war debts and were faced with the tedious task of rebuilding, to recuperate the soonest time possible. So, in order for them to achieve this, they need to take full control of the country's resources as well as the people through the use of terror and persecution to ensure forcible submission.
